The death of a Hawker in Calcutta – Who is Responsible? Hawker is not an English word! However it is a very common tern in Calcutta. In 1996, the left front government started the “Operation Sunshine” to eradicate hawkers from the Calcutta’s pavements. During the clean up even by Calcutta Municipal Corporation (CMC) about 1640 stalls were ransacked, looted, set on fire and razed to the ground. 102 hawkers were arrested.
Facts: 1. Hawkers in Kolkata numbering 275,000 generated business worth Rs. 8,772 crore (around 2 billion U.S. dollars) in 2005. 2. Almost 80 per cent of the pavements in Calcutta were encroached by hawkers and illegal settlers

Polulation is Calcutta has grown dramatically in last several decades. The extreme polpulation growth did not offer everybody a better life. Instend, like many other urban cities in India, the new population found themselves surrounded by huge poverty. The 1951 census found that only 33.2 percent of Kolkata’s inhabitants were city-born, the rest were immigrants: 12.3 percent were from elsewhere in West Bengal, 26.6 percent from other Indian states, and 26.9 percent from East Pakistan. In 1981, the Government of West Bengal estimated the total number of persons displaced from East Bengal to the state to be around 8 million or one sixth of the total population of the state. Several million refugees settled in the outskirts of Kolkata.
While the economy of Kolkata has been sliding backwards in many respects, there has been remarkable expansion in certain areas – real estate, information technology and retail trade. Big shopping centres have come up, and along with it there has been a large increase in small shops and pavement stalls. INOX like movie complexes are setting the trend in Calcutta Life. Several Night Clubs are keeping the calcuttans awake even late at night. Tata Nano is also reacing the middle class families.
Even after all of our improvents in terms of buildings and shopping complexes and fly-overs, there are still a great many people who has no job. There are too many young fellw with a bachelors degree looking for work. With more people, there exist more competetion. It is not uncommon to receive 100s of applications for only a mere 5000 rupess/month job in Calcutta. So, people are still exploring other options. When they are left with nothing, the choose Hawking as an option.
We see hawkers everywhere. They are at the streets selling cloths, books (think about College Square), food products (Futchka, Jhalmuri etc), electronics (Cameras, Watches, CDs, Movies, etc) and what not. But even being a hawker is not an easy job. There are too many hawkers selling too many products. Sometimes some of the vital sopts in the city are already booked by old hawkers too. Sometimes the Hawkers Association also have few things to say. So people have long started exploring various places apart from the city pavements in Calcutta. In local trains to Howrah or Sealdah, you will pretty much find every kind of products during your short journey including soap, tooth-paste, tooth brush, weighing machine, choths, foods, vegetables and what not.
Those hawkers hardly get any rest. They compete with other hawkers in the same compartment in the train. They sale their products cheap and does not make enough money compared to the hardship they have to take to earn their livelihood. They have also spread in buses for quite some time.
